Cedar Pond Farms delivers an absolutely delightful Highland cow experience that keeps visitors raving. The intimate, small-group sessions give you plenty of time to feed, brush, and pet these fluffy beauties, each with their own distinct personality. The facility stands out for its cleanliness and attention to detail, creating a welcoming atmosphere that feels special from start to finish. Guides like Hannah, Tim, Allie, and Noah consistently earn praise for their knowledge about the breed and genuine enthusiasm, making sure everyone stays safe while getting up close with the horned cuties. Beyond the cow encounters, visitors love the thoughtful extras: complimentary gelato and coffee afterward, accommodating staff who bring chairs for those with mobility concerns, and even photo assistance. Families find it perfect for all ages, while couples appreciate it as a unique date or gift idea. Some guests also rave about the on-site lodging (the Barndo), which comes fully equipped with fun touches like collecting your own eggs for breakfast and proximity to the animals.
